猿问
Java接口
网上说接口最大的好处是客户端未知情况下修改实现代码,请问什么叫客户端未知呀,求大神解释
凉鹜
浏览 1151
回答 1
1回答
老卫
面向接口编程,就是定义好接口,再做具体的实现。接口是提供给调用方的“契约”,具体接口如何实现不用关心。这样,接口提供方做具体的实现,实现细节即便变更了,对于接口来说是没有变化的,也就是说对于接口的调用方来说,感觉不到任何的变化。就是你问题里面说的“客户端未知”
1
0
0
随时随地看视频
慕课网APP
相关分类
Java
我要回答